This paper focuses on the simplification of the on-line programming process of industrial robots. It presents a modular on-line programming environment (software and hardware), which supports an intuitive way of moving and teaching robots, while supporting the user with assisting algorithms like collision avoidance and automatic path planning. Main idea is the combination of different approaches from tele-operation, programming by demonstration and off-line programming, and reuse them in a new fashion on-line on the shopfloor. The proposed programming environment is designed to evaluate the usability of different combination of assisting techniques.
